NOT much was going right for Cameron Munster on Sunday night.

His side was beaten by the Roosters in the NRL grand final, and the Storm five-eighth was sin binned twice in the 21-6 defeat.

And on the second occasion, he was brutally trolled by the ANZ Stadium DJ.

When Munster was binned for kicking Joseph Manu in the head inexplicably, the DJ started blaring Ray Charles’ classic ‘Hit The Road Jack’ through the stadium sound system.

The cheeky swipe was picked up by fans and pointed out on social media.

Munster was visibly shattered as he walked off the field, and appeared to be crying as he headed down the tunnel.
